Aggregate Solutions for Randleman's Unique Soil Conditions
The Piedmont region surrounding Randleman features distinctive red clay Cecil soil that presents specific challenges for construction and drainage projects. This heavy, expansive clay can retain moisture, shift with seasonal changes, and create drainage issues without proper aggregate base preparation. Understanding these local geological conditions is essential for successful project completion.
Why Aggregate Selection Matters in Randleman
Randleman experiences a humid subtropical climate with approximately 45 inches of annual rainfall distributed throughout the year. Summer afternoon thunderstorms and winter precipitation events can dump significant moisture on properties in short periods. The underlying red clay Piedmont soil, while stable when properly managed, can become problematic without adequate drainage infrastructure and properly selected base aggregates.
Properties throughout Randleman, from those near the historic Randleman Depot to rural areas along Old Liberty Road, benefit from aggregates that provide excellent drainage characteristics while compacting firmly enough to create stable surfaces. The freeze-thaw cycles that occasionally occur during North Carolina winters can also impact improperly constructed surfaces, making quality aggregate selection crucial for long-term durability.
Driveway Construction in Randleman
Building a durable driveway in Randleman requires understanding how local clay soils interact with aggregate base materials. Most successful driveways in the area begin with proper excavation to remove unstable topsoil, followed by installation of a thick compacted aggregate base layer. Properties near Lake Brandt and throughout the Worthville area particularly benefit from this approach due to the prevalence of heavy clay soils.
For optimal driveway performance, we recommend a minimum base depth of four to six inches of compacted aggregate. In areas with poor drainage or heavy clay, increasing the base depth to eight inches provides additional stability and longevity. The compaction process is critical—each layer should be thoroughly compacted using a vibratory plate compactor or roller to achieve maximum density and load-bearing capacity.
Randleman Aggregate Comparison Guide
Selecting the right aggregate for your specific Randleman project ensures optimal performance and longevity. This comparison helps you understand which materials work best for different applications in our Piedmont climate:
| Aggregate Type | Best Applications | Drainage Rating | Compaction | Clay Soil Performance |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Crusher Run | Driveway base, parking areas, roads | Excellent | Superior | Outstanding - ideal for clay |
| 3/4" Crushed Stone | Drainage layers, foundations, base material | Excellent | Very Good | Excellent stability |
| #57 Stone | French drains, concrete aggregate, utility bedding | Outstanding | Good | Perfect for drainage systems |
| Road Base | Heavy-duty driveways, roads, commercial lots | Excellent | Superior | Excellent for high-traffic areas |
| Pea Gravel | Walkways, decorative borders, gardens | Good | Minimal | Best for surface applications |
| River Rock | Landscaping, water features, decorative areas | Good | None | Surface use only |
| Decomposed Granite | Natural pathways, rustic driveways, gardens | Very Good | Good | Compacts well over clay |
| Crushed Concrete | Eco-friendly base, sub-base, temp roads | Excellent | Very Good | Cost-effective for clay sites |

Drainage Solutions for Randleman's Clay Soil
Effective drainage design is absolutely critical for any construction project in Randleman due to the area's heavy clay soils and substantial annual rainfall. Properties throughout the region commonly experience water retention issues, erosion problems, and foundation concerns when drainage isn't properly addressed. The key to successful drainage in clay soil environments is creating pathways for water to move away from structures and surfaces efficiently.
French Drain Installation
French drains represent one of the most effective drainage solutions for Randleman properties. These systems use perforated pipe surrounded by clean aggregate to collect and redirect groundwater away from problem areas. The stone allows water to enter the pipe while preventing fine clay particles from clogging the system. Properties near Deep River and in low-lying areas particularly benefit from properly constructed French drain systems.
Driveway and Foundation Drainage
Every driveway and structure built on Randleman's clay soils should incorporate proper drainage infrastructure. This typically includes aggregate base layers that allow water to percolate downward and away from the surface, combined with strategic grading to direct surface water to appropriate collection or dispersal areas. Foundation drains around buildings prevent hydrostatic pressure buildup that can cause basement leaks and structural damage.
Erosion Control on Slopes
The rolling topography common throughout Randolph County creates challenges for erosion control, especially where slopes meet clay soils. Strategic placement of aggregates in erosion-prone areas, combined with proper grading and vegetation, stabilizes slopes and prevents the washing away of valuable topsoil during heavy rain events common throughout the year.

Calculating Aggregate Quantities
Accurate quantity calculations prevent costly shortages or excess material. For driveway and base applications, calculate the area in square feet (length times width), then multiply by the desired depth in feet. Convert this cubic footage to cubic yards by dividing by 27. Add 10-15% extra to account for compaction and waste.
For example, a driveway 12 feet wide by 100 feet long with a 4-inch base requires: 12 x 100 = 1,200 square feet. Converting 4 inches to feet (0.33 feet), multiply 1,200 x 0.33 = 396 cubic feet. Dividing by 27 yields approximately 14.7 cubic yards. Adding 15% gives roughly 17 cubic yards needed for the project.
Site Preparation Requirements
Proper site preparation is essential for aggregate projects in Randleman. This typically involves removing existing vegetation, excavating unsuitable topsoil and organic material, and creating proper grade. In clay soil areas, excavation depth should reach stable subgrade. Many contractors recommend excavating six to eight inches deeper than the finished grade to accommodate adequate aggregate base depth.
Compaction and Installation Best Practices
Achieving proper compaction is crucial for long-term performance, especially in Randleman's clay soil environment. Install aggregate base in lifts (layers) no thicker than four inches, compacting each lift thoroughly before adding the next. Use vibratory plate compactors for smaller areas and vibratory rollers for larger projects. Proper moisture content during compaction—usually slightly damp but not saturated—helps achieve optimal density.
Seasonal Considerations
While aggregate projects can proceed year-round in Randleman's moderate climate, certain seasons offer advantages. Spring and fall provide ideal temperatures and generally manageable moisture levels. Summer heat can make compaction work challenging, though morning and evening hours work well. Winter projects are feasible during dry periods, but avoid working when frost is present or predicted. The key is ensuring proper drainage before rainy seasons arrive to prevent erosion and damage to newly installed aggregates.
